Start Training I find the earlier you start training the better results I get Using Loopholes New L.O.G Spacing Training Growing technique. I simply bend the branch down (in which I want to be trained) slot the spacer under a node and on to the branch, the force of the branch pushing up holds the spacer in perfect position. Also slotting a spacer inbetween the top head's force's the plant's growth exactly the way you want. Then you simply repeat the processes using larger sizes. Last week I started with a 3cm spacer, the 3 top head's grew 9cm apart (3rd head bit shorter). This week I'm starting with a 12cm spacer, nearly all branches now have spacers on (bending them) This will now naturally occur bending this wil reduce vertical growth and expose more of the plants surface to maximum light, gaining more tops😁 The other 11Roses has also now got a 10cm spacer inbetween her 2 head's.
